Do you want an Infobox made for your timeline. I am now  going to start taking requests. Five  rules:

1) I can make maps for the box, but I can not make logos. So if you want an alternate party infobox, you need to provide that for me.
2)Requests can take anywhere between a few minutes and a few days to get done. Its not that the boxes take a particularly long time, but I have my own boxes to make still, and I also have a life otside of Atlas.
3)There are certain boxes I wont make, and I will tell you upfront that I wont make them. The only one thats a major problem to make is the box that dispalys all of the candidates in the primary. They can take an absurd amount of time to make, so I will only do them for my own timeline or with some rare exceptions.
4)One request at a time per person. If you dump 6 on me at once Im going to ignore them.
5) I must be credited somehow. A simple note saying made by Edgeofnight would be fine.
